Most of our campaign websites run between $3,000 and $10,000, depending on scope and how custom the features are. A straightforward down-ballot site sits near the bottom of that range; a larger campaign with a constituent portal, ticketing, and heavy CRM integration sits near the top. We publish our rates and give a free quote within one business day.
Because we build on a customized template system rather than from scratch every time, most campaign sites go live in days, not months — fast enough for a live race with a fixed calendar. Rush timelines around a filing deadline or a debate are something we do regularly.
